A brilliantly bold Dinked package to celebrate this spirited and vibrant 11-song suite from the London-based jazz / afrobeat fusionists – our first (and very proud) collaboration with Gilles Peterson’s esteemed Brownswood record label. The second album from Kokoroko is a magical listen, exploring themes of togetherness, community, sensuality, childhood, loss and, above all, perseverance.
The eye-catching
artwork (presented here in an alternative sleeve for the exclusive Dinked Edition colourway), was painted by the acclaimed illustrator, Luci Pina, & the imagery and colour was inspired by feelings of innocence and nostalgia - coming of age in London and those rare summer nights where everything felt full of hope.
